    Improvement of corrosion resistance of aluminum using super-hydrophobic method
    (Terengganu: Universiti Malaysia Terengganu, 2009) Mohd Alif Osman
    A novel super-hydrophobic film was prepared by Livingston solution chemically adsorbed onto the aluminum. A superhydrophobic surface was prepared on aluminum substrate. The film formation and its structure were characterized by means of Fourier transformation infrared spectroscopy (FTIR) and scanning electron microscopy (SEM). The formation of a composite interface composed of the flower-like surface nanostructures, water droplet and air trapped in the crevices was suggested to be responsible for the superior water-repellent property. The corrosion behavior of the super-hydrophobic surface was investigated with potentiodynamic polarization measurements and electrochemical impedance spectroscopy. Due to the 'air valleys' and 'capillarity' effects, the corrosion resistance of the material was improved remarkably.
